(1.) On the joint request made by the learned counsel for the parties, the hearing of the present contempt petition is pre -poned from 13.7.2016 to today, and the same is taken on board.
(2.) The present contempt petition has been filed by Village Health Guide Association, praying that the respondents be punished for willful disobedience of the order dated 23.9.2013 passed by this Court
in S.B. CWP No. 4370/2012. The operative portion of the order dated 23.9.2013 passed in the above
said writ petition, reads as under: -
In view of the limited prayer made above, this writ petition is disposed of with liberty as prayed for. If any representation is made by the petitioner, the respondents are directed to consider and decide the same within a period of one month from the date of submission of representation as well as this order Mr. S.K. Gupta, the learned Addl. Advocate General appearing for the respondent no.2 has submitted that the representation has been filed by the Union stating therein that some of the members have not been paid honorarium. Mr. Gupta further submitted that the representation filed is vague, as no particulars and details of the members have been given. It is also not stated therein that which member had not been paid honorarium and he had worked at which place and for which period.
(3.) The learned counsel for the petitioner has submitted that subsequently on the information sought by the respondents, he had furnished the list of the members giving their particulars.;
